Johnson & Johnson MedTech is recruiting for a Senior Director- Strategy and Planning (SID) to be located in Santa Clara, CA.
Johnson & Johnson MedTech offers a broad range of products, platforms and technologies ranging from surgical sutures to complex robotics in various clinical specialties such as electrophysiology, orthopedics, general surgery, and ophthalmology. The sector offers very broad range of products such as implants to hand held devices and complex robotic systems. As the industry is moving into smart/informed surgery visualization systems have gained more prominence within the sectors key focus areas.
The Planning and Strategy, Innovation & Deployment (SI&D) Leader will be responsible for leading end to end efforts (E2E) to identify, shape transformational initiatives (network optimization & broader E2E opportunities), deliver platform strategies, and lead the planning team in the Robotics and Digital part of MedTech.
